The Inspiring Journey of Kwan Tsui Hang: A Trailblazer in Macao's Political Landscape
Kwan Tsui Hang is a remarkable figure who has made significant contributions to the political and social fabric of Macao, a Special Administrative Region of China. Born in the mid-20th century, Kwan Tsui Hang has been a prominent advocate for labor rights and social welfare, playing a pivotal role in shaping policies that impact the lives of many in Macao. Her journey began in a time when Macao was undergoing rapid changes, and she emerged as a leader who championed the causes of the working class and marginalized communities. Her work has been instrumental in the legislative assembly, where she has served multiple terms, advocating for policies that promote equality and justice.
Kwan Tsui Hang's influence extends beyond her legislative work. She has been actively involved in various social organizations, contributing to the development of Macao's civil society.
